Studying a Bachelor of Biomedical Science in Busselton offers aspiring health professionals a foundational understanding of various scientific principles that are essential in healthcare settings. Busselton, located in the scenic southwestern region of Australia, is home to La Trobe University, an esteemed training provider delivering this program through an online mode, making it accessible to students from all over the area. This localised education option is ideal for students seeking to embark on a career in the healthcare sector.

The Bachelor of Biomedical Science is interconnected with various fields such as healthcare courses and science courses. This comprehensive curriculum expands knowledge in areas like medical administration, forensic science, and pharmacy. By enrolling, students gain insights invaluable for pursuing successful careers in these diverse fields.

Graduates of the Bachelor of Biomedical Science program can pursue a range of rewarding career paths. Potential job roles include Biomedical Scientist, Medical Scientist, and Clinical Laboratory Technician. These roles not only contribute significantly to healthcare improvements but also offer diverse opportunities for professional advancement in Busselton and beyond.

The educational rigor of the Bachelor of Biomedical Science program equips students with essential skills that are highly sought after in the industry. Graduates can find themselves working in various capacities, including Clinical Researcher, Clinical Physiologist, and IVF Specialist. With an ever-growing demand for qualified professionals in healthcare, this degree unlocks doors to numerous employment avenues.
